GIFT PARCELS

CHRISTMAS CHEER APPEAL FOR SOLDIERS. OVER £2OO RAISED YESTERDAY. The appeal made in Masterton yesterday for funds to provide Christmas cheer gift parcels for soldiers overseas met with a most gratifying response, a sum. of £2OB 14s being collected, with some donations still to come in. Throughout yesterday members of the Masterton Ladies’ Patriotic Committee and helpers conducted a street sale and a house to house canvass. The committee wishes to thank all donors of cash and kind and collectors for their ready assistance with the appeal. It is the aim of the appeal to provide every soldier overseas with a Christmas gift parcel and the response made in Masterton ensures the local quota being provided for.
